Regression Testing

Explore agent skills de Regression Testing em Seguranca e compare workflows, ferramentas e casos de uso relacionados.

21 skills
A
tdd-workflow

por affaan-m

tdd-workflow é uma skill de workflow test-first para novas funcionalidades, correções de bugs e refatorações. Ela impõe TDD com cobertura de 80%+ em testes unitários, de integração e E2E, além de checkpoints explícitos e validação de casos de borda. Use a skill tdd-workflow quando precisar de um guia prático para Automação de Testes e mudanças de código mais previsíveis.

Test Automation
Favoritos 0GitHub 156.3k
A
springboot-verification

por affaan-m

springboot-verification é um loop de verificação para projetos Spring Boot que ajuda a confirmar se uma mudança é segura antes de abrir um PR ou fazer deploy. Use este guia da springboot-verification para validação de build, análise estática, testes com cobertura, varreduras de segurança e Skill Validation.

Skill Validation
Favoritos 0GitHub 156.3k
A
rust-testing

por affaan-m

rust-testing é um guia prático de padrões de testes em Rust, incluindo testes unitários, testes de integração, testes assíncronos, testes baseados em propriedades, mocks e cobertura. Ele ajuda você a escolher o formato certo de teste e seguir um fluxo de TDD com menos tentativas e erros.

Skill Testing
Favoritos 0GitHub 156.2k
A
canary-watch

por affaan-m

canary-watch é uma skill de monitoramento pós-deploy para verificar uma URL em produção e identificar regressões após releases, merges ou atualizações de dependências, em staging ou produção.

Monitoring
Favoritos 0GitHub 156.1k
A
ai-regression-testing

por affaan-m

A skill ai-regression-testing ajuda a identificar bugs que o desenvolvimento assistido por IA часто deixa passar, incluindo correções incompletas, premissas desatualizadas e regressões entre caminhos de sandbox e produção. Use esta skill ai-regression-testing para Testes de Regressão quando um agente tiver alterado rotas de API, lógica de backend ou correções de bugs que exigem verificações práticas e repetíveis. Ela é especialmente útil para validação em modo sandbox sem banco de dados e para fluxos de revisão que expõem ramificações ocultas.

Regression Testing
Favoritos 0GitHub 156k
G
benchmark

por garrytan

A skill de benchmark ajuda a detectar regressões de performance em fluxos de trabalho web e de aplicativos. Use-a para estabelecer uma linha de base, comparar antes e depois de mudanças e acompanhar se uma PR deixou páginas mais lentas, mais pesadas ou menos estáveis. É um guia prático de benchmark para otimização de performance, Core Web Vitals, verificações do Lighthouse, tamanho de bundle e tendências de tempo de carregamento.

Performance Optimization
Favoritos 0GitHub 91.8k
G
canary

por garrytan

canary é uma skill de monitoramento pós-deploy que acompanha apps em produção em busca de erros no console, falhas de página e regressões de desempenho. Ela compara o comportamento atual com uma linha de base pré-deploy, para que você possa validar uma release, identificar páginas quebradas e notar anomalias visíveis com menos suposição do que em um prompt genérico.

Monitoring
Favoritos 0GitHub 91.8k
G
qa-only

por garrytan

qa-only é uma skill de QA só com relatório para testar apps web, documentar bugs e capturar evidências sem fazer correções. Foi criada para revisores de QA e agentes que precisam de um relatório de bug estruturado, pontuação de saúde, screenshots e passos de reprodução. Use qa-only quando você quiser um fluxo de relatório de bugs em vez de testar, corrigir e verificar novamente.

Qa
Favoritos 0GitHub 91.8k
G
qa

por garrytan

A skill de qa testa sistematicamente uma aplicação web, encontra bugs e valida correções com um fluxo de trabalho em etapas. Use-a para testes de regressão, checagens de prontidão para release ou como um guia estruturado de QA quando você precisar de evidências, classificação de severidade e ciclos curtos de corrigir e retestar, em vez de um prompt genérico de caça a bugs.

Regression Testing
Favoritos 0GitHub 91.8k
A
test-driven-development

por addyosmani

A skill test-driven-development ajuda você a modificar código escrevendo primeiro um teste que falha e, depois, fazendo a menor correção possível para passar. Use em mudanças de lógica, correção de bugs, regressões e casos de borda em que a prova vale mais do que um conserto apenas plausível.

Skill Testing
Favoritos 0GitHub 18.8k
T
hunt

por tw93

hunt é uma skill focada em depuração que obriga a pensar em causa raiz antes de aplicar qualquer correção. Use para erros, crashes, regressões, testes com falha, problemas de cache desatualizado, bugs de screenshot e falhas do tipo “funcionava antes”. Ela ajuda você a chegar a uma hipótese testável, reunir evidências e evitar chute. Não é para revisão de código nem para novas funcionalidades.

Debugging
Favoritos 0GitHub 5.1k
T
ossfuzz

por trailofbits

Aprenda a skill ossfuzz para configuração de fuzzing contínuo, inscrição de projetos, planejamento de harnesses e revisão do fluxo de build. Este guia ajuda engenheiros de segurança e mantenedores a avaliar a prontidão, identificar bloqueios de build e preparar um caminho prático do código-fonte até o OSS-Fuzz ou uma infraestrutura privada de fuzzing.

Security Audit
Favoritos 0GitHub 5k
T
libfuzzer

por trailofbits

libfuzzer é um fuzzer guiado por cobertura para projetos C/C++ compilados com Clang. Esta skill do libfuzzer ajuda você a instalar, entender e usar o fluxo de trabalho para criar harnesses para alvos, executar sanitizers e iniciar uma auditoria prática de segurança com configuração mínima.

Security Audit
Favoritos 0GitHub 5k
T
fuzzing-obstacles

por trailofbits

fuzzing-obstacles ajuda você a adaptar um programa-alvo para que fuzzers consigam contornar checksums, estado global, gates de validação e outros bloqueios. Use esta skill de fuzzing-obstacles para tornar um System Under Test mais fácil de fuzzar sem alterar o comportamento em produção. É um guia prático para fluxos de Security Audit e para ampliar a cobertura em profundidade.

Security Audit
Favoritos 0GitHub 5k
T
cargo-fuzz

por trailofbits

cargo-fuzz é uma skill de fuzzing para Rust/Cargo, usada para criar harnesses com libFuzzer, executar com suporte de sanitizers e encontrar crashes em código de parser, unsafe e tratamento de entrada. Use este guia de cargo-fuzz quando precisar de orientação prática de instalação e uso para auditoria de segurança e testes de regressão em projetos baseados em Cargo.

Security Audit
Favoritos 0GitHub 5k
T
address-sanitizer

por trailofbits

address-sanitizer ajuda você a instalar e usar o AddressSanitizer (ASan) para detectar bugs de segurança de memória durante testes, fuzzing e triagem de crashes. É útil para código C/C++, código unsafe em Rust e fluxos de auditoria de segurança quando você precisa de stack traces reproduzíveis e sinais de falha mais claros.

Security Audit
Favoritos 0GitHub 5k
A
playwright-testing

por alinaqi

skill playwright-testing para escrever e depurar testes end-to-end com Playwright, com page objects, execuções em múltiplos navegadores, configuração amigável para CI, tratamento de autenticação e estrutura de testes estável.

Skill Testing
Favoritos 0GitHub 607
T
playwright-skill

por testdino-hq

playwright-skill é um guia específico para Playwright voltado a automação de navegador confiável. Ele ajuda equipes a escrever, depurar e escalar testes para fluxos E2E, validações de API, testes de componentes, regressão visual, acessibilidade, autenticação, CI/CD e migração de Cypress ou Selenium. Use a skill playwright-skill quando você quiser padrões práticos em vez de conselhos genéricos sobre testes.

Test Automation
Favoritos 0GitHub 0
M
azure-microsoft-playwright-testing-ts

por microsoft

azure-microsoft-playwright-testing-ts ajuda você a configurar execuções de testes do Playwright no Azure Playwright Workspaces com TypeScript. Use-o para automação de navegador em escala, navegadores hospedados na nuvem, integração com CI/CD, autenticação com Microsoft Entra e relatórios no portal do Azure. Inclui orientações de instalação, configuração e uso.

Browser Automation
Favoritos 0GitHub 0
T
wycheproof

por trailofbits

A skill wycheproof ajuda a validar implementações criptográficas com vetores de teste do Wycheproof, com foco em ataques conhecidos, casos de borda e decisões de aprovação/reprovação em fluxos de trabalho de auditoria de segurança. Use-a para inspecionar AES-GCM, ECDSA, ECDH, RSA e primitivos relacionados com bem menos tentativa e erro do que um prompt genérico sobre criptografia.

Security Audit
Favoritos 0GitHub 0
S
qa-test-planner

por softaworks

qa-test-planner é uma skill de QA com acionamento explícito, feita para criar planos de teste, casos de teste manuais, suítes de regressão, notas de validação de design no Figma e relatórios de bugs estruturados a partir do contexto de uma funcionalidade ou release.

Acceptance Testing
Favoritos 0GitHub 0
Regression Testing agent skills